David Beckham accepts invite for dinner with King Charles to discuss being a charity ambassador for The Prince’s Foundation – after distancing himself from Harry and Meghan

David Beckham has accepted an invitation from the King to attend a dinner after severing ties with Prince Harry.

The former England star is dining with Charles to talk about the possibility of him becoming an ambassador for The Prince’s Foundation, a charity founded by the King in order to help provide skills to young people.

Mr Beckham has previously held a similar role representing Invictus Games, the multi-sport competition for sick and injured servicemen and women founded by Prince Harry in 2014.

But the ex-footballer has since distanced himself from the Duke of Sussex after he and wife Meghan relocated to the US and stepped back as senior royals in 2020.

Sources close to Mr Beckham say that he is hoping for a honour such as a knighthood, the Sun reported.

He was awarded an OBE back in June 2003 for services to football.

More recently in 2017, his wife Victoria received the same honour for her contribution to fashion.

The 48-year-old’s chances of being knighted were previously blighted after he was one of 1,000 people caught up in the scandal involving Ingenious films, including former teammate Wayne Rooney, who all lost their case to overturn a £700million bill of avoided tax in 2017.

It’s possible that Mr Beckham will meet King Charles at the Foundation’s base, Dumfries House, in east Ayrshire, Scotland.

A source suggested that the meeting would be an opportunity for the King to ‘suss out’ Mr Beckham and find out in what areas they could work together.
